Coyote Peak
Coyote Peak is a peak in Colusa County, Sacramento Valley, California and has an elevation of 1,716 feet. Coyote Peak is situated nearby to the locality Hamilton Flat, as well as near Widow Flats.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Wilbur Hot Springs, formerly known as Simmons Hot Springs, is a naturally occurring historic hot spring approximately 22 miles west of Williams, Colusa County, in northern California.
